uk.ign.com/articles/2018/01/16/suicide-squad-2-rumored-to-be-ben-afflecks-final-appearance-as-batmanSuicide Squad 2 is rumored to be the final movie for Ben Affleck's Batman. According to Batman-On-Film, it's now looking likely Affleck's last stint as the Dark Knight may come in the Suicide Squad sequel rather than in Flashpoint, as reported last year. With Justice League's underwhelming box office performance, it's currently unknown if Flashpoint will get made, according to the site. It's also worth noting Affleck has worked with Suicide Squad 2 director Gavin O’Connor before on 2016's The Accountant, and had a brief cameo appearance in the first Suicide Squad movie. However, it's not known just how big of a role Affleck's Batman will have in the sequel, which is reportedly scheduled to begin filming in October of this year.
